Associate Engineer - Water Resources
surbanajurong · Sydney
Job description
About the role
SMEC is looking for an Associate Water Resources Engineer to join its Water Resources team in Sydney. You will work primarily on New South Wales projects while also supporting the broader ANZ business, contributing to flood risk, waterway, urban and rural‑irrigation management initiatives.
Key responsibilities
- Conduct technical assessments and design for water resource management projects.
- Perform peer reviews to ensure compliance with client and SMEC standards.
- Mentor and review the work of junior engineers.
- Collaborate with team members, clients and stakeholders to deliver high‑quality, timely project outputs.
- Apply project management principles to meet deliverables on schedule.
Required profile
- Bachelor’s degree in Civil or Environmental Engineering.
- Minimum 10 + years experience in water resources management or design.
- Experience in an engineering design consultancy and a track record of delivering successful projects.
- Familiarity with relevant Australian Standards.
- Ability to lead projects and contribute to business development.
- Working towards or holding CPEng status.
Required skills
- Hydrology modelling software.
- Hydraulic modelling software.
